Understanding the AR-15 Gas System

The AR-15 gas system plays a crucial role in the operation of this popular rifle platform. Let’s delve into how this system works and its significance in cycling the rifle effectively.

Gas Propulsion and Escape

  • As the trigger is pulled, the expanding gases generated by the ignited gunpowder propel the bullet down the barrel.
  • Simultaneously, a portion of these gases escapes through the gas port located in the barrel.

Gas Tube and Dwell Time

  • The high-pressure gas quickly travels through the gas tube, connecting the gas port to a chamber situated between the bolt and the carrier.
  • The dwell time refers to the duration the bullet remains in this chamber from the moment it passes the gas port until it exits the muzzle.

Cycling Mechanism

  • The pressure of the trapped gas behind the bullet is essential for the cycling mechanism of the AR-15.
  • The chamber between the bolt and carrier functions akin to a pneumatic cylinder, crucial for the rifle's operation.

Bolt Movement and Extraction

  • With the bolt initially unable to move forward due to the pressure, the carrier is forced to the rear.
  • As the bullet exits the muzzle and the pressure decreases, the carrier gains enough momentum to retract the bolt efficiently.

Gas Release and Shell Extraction

  • The two vents on the carrier align with the gas rings on the bolt, allowing the release of remaining gases from the chamber.
  • Continued rearward motion of the bolt carrier results in the extraction of the spent shell casing from the chamber.
